N.-E. Dionne, The Makers of Canada: Champlain
“ How could he rely upon these people, to whom a thousand men represented simply an amazing number? How could the Hurons make a census of an unsedentary people, wandering here and there according to circumstances of war or other reasons, and recruiting themselves with prisoners or with the remnants of conquered nations?To give only one example of these strange recruitings, let us examine the composition of the great family of the Iroquois in Champlain's time. ”
